What is the importance of building architecture?

The Importance of Architecture At its roots, architecture exists to create the physical environment in which people live, but architecture is more than just the built environment, it’s also a part of our culture. It stands as a representation of how we see ourselves, as well as how we see the world.

What is the most influential piece of architecture in the world and why?

Eiffel Tower – Paris, France Constructed in 1889, the Eiffel Tower is one of the most famous structures in the world. It’s named after the engineer Gustave Eiffel and it was build as the entrance arch for the World Expo of 1889. The tower is 324 meters high, approximately as an 81 storey building.

What makes a good building design?

Good buildings create a positive emotional response. Sadly, we see a multitude of buildings being created that make little contribution to our built environment. So what are these principles that the RFAC put forward? They are order and unity, expression, integrity, plan and section, detail and integration.
